Problem

Existing boundary marking tapes face issues with inconsistent coloring, adhesive squeeze-out leading to delamination, and edge catching on cleaning devices, which results in dirt retention and damage.

Innovation Solution

A floor tape with a beveled edge and recessed adhesive structure to prevent lifting and delamination, a glossy surface to reduce dirt retention, and a rigid body for durability, along with a specific polymer composition and adhesive formulation to enhance adhesion and durability.

1Reliability

If adhesive is applied adjacent the lower surface to hold the tape to the floor, then the tape is securely attached, but the adhesive is squeezed out the side of the tape where it collects dirt and helps to delaminate the tape from the floor

Engineering Contradiction:
Improvetape attachment securityVSAvoidadhesive squeeze-out causing delamination and dirt retention
Core Design Contradiction:
ReliabilityVSObject-generated harmful factors

Solution Approach 1:

The patent applies local quality by creating a recessed adhesive layer only in specific areas (adjacent to the lower surface but not at the edges) rather than uniformly across the entire lower surface. This localized adhesive placement secures the tape to the floor while preventing squeeze-out at the lateral edges, directly resolving the contradiction between secure attachment and preventing delamination.

Inventive Principle:
Principle #3Local quality

Solution Approach 2:

The adhesive layer is segmented into distinct regions: a recessed adhesive area for secure attachment and adhesive-free lateral edges for preventing delamination. This segmentation allows the tape to simultaneously achieve strong floor attachment while avoiding the harmful effect of adhesive squeeze-out at the edges.

Inventive Principle:
Principle #1Segmentation

2Manufacturing precision

If the tape edge is sharp for clean lines, then the marking is precise, but the edge is prone to being caught on floor cleaning devices or skids

Engineering Contradiction:
Improvemarking line precisionVSAvoidedge catching on cleaning devices
Core Design Contradiction:
Manufacturing precisionVSObject-affected harmful factors

Solution Approach 1:

The patent applies curvature by beveling the lateral edges of the tape body to create a gradual transition from the top surface to the bottom surface. This beveled edge maintains the precision of the marking line while eliminating the sharp edge that would otherwise be caught on floor cleaning devices or skids, directly resolving the contradiction between marking precision and resistance to mechanical damage.

Inventive Principle:
Principle #14Spheroidality (Curvature)

AI summary

A floor marking tape has a structure that retains the adhesive under the tape to prevent the adhesive from being squeezed out from under the tape when the tape is in use on a floor. In one embodiment, the structure is a shoulder that defines a recess that holds the bulk of the adhesive. The shoulder prevents the adhesive from flowing out to the outer edge of the tape. The tape may have beveled edges that limit the unintentional lifting and delamination of the tape from the floor. The upper surface of the tape may be curved from edge-to-edge to limit dirt retention on the tape as well as allowing objects to slide over the tape.
